Hello

I no longer have any need for my Evernote account and would like to cancel it. My membership was taken out less than 60 days ago via iTunes. 

When I try to cancel it on the Evernote website, it refers me to Apple as it was purchased via iTunes

Apple/iTunes has said that they do not offer refunds for cancelled subscriptions which I feel is grossly unfair...

Any ideas to get my money back or do I accept 'this is the way it is'?
